A video showcasing a new iron welding technology from China has attracted widespread attention on social media after claims emerged that the innovation could transform industrial manufacturing and engineering methods worldwide.
The footage, shared by Moscow News on social media platforms, shows a modern welding device operating through an advanced automated system. Viewers described the process as highly precise and efficient, while many users expressed surprise at the technologyโs speed and accuracy.

According to posts circulating online, the welding system appears to use smart automation to perform iron welding with minimal manual involvement. The video quickly gained traction after social media users claimed the technology could significantly change industrial production and infrastructure development in the future.
However, experts and technology observers have urged caution regarding exaggerated claims surrounding the device. Although advanced welding systems powered by robotics and artificial intelligence are increasingly being introduced in manufacturing industries, no official technical details have yet confirmed that the showcased technology represents a revolutionary breakthrough capable of โcompletely crushing the world,โ as claimed in some online posts.
China has invested heavily in automation, robotics and industrial innovation in recent years as part of efforts to strengthen its manufacturing sector and global technological competitiveness. Chinese companies and research institutions have continued developing advanced machinery for construction, aerospace, shipbuilding and heavy industries.
Meanwhile, the viral video has reignited debate over the rapid pace of technological advancement and the growing role of artificial intelligence in industrial operations. Supporters praised the innovation for demonstrating the future of smart manufacturing, while critics argued that social media posts often exaggerate the capabilities of emerging technologies without independent verification.
The clip continues to circulate widely online as users discuss its potential impact on global industry and engineering practices.
